The Mystery Coconuts is an inspirational book written out of burden for the global spate of marital challenges. Drawing inspiration from her marital experiences and of those around her, as well as some inspirational books and sermons, Chika Holly Maduka shares a divine blueprint for successful and pleasant marital relationships. These metaphorical coconuts can bring healing and sweetness into an ailing and bitter relationship. The coconut is a wonderful universal fruit. Outside is a hard shell, but the insides are both food and antidote. The principles in this book may be very hard like coconut shell. But by faith and willingness, it can be 'broken' and enjoyed. This book is not written for those who are not willing to obey divine injunctions. It is written for those who are willing to bring transformation into their marriages through obedience to the revelation in the word of God. 'For the preaching of the cross is to them that perish foolishness; but unto us which are saved, it is the power of God. But we preach Christ crucified, unto the Jews, a stumbling block, and unto the Greeks, foolishness' (1 Corinthians 1:18, 23). Are you willing to build with God? About the Author Chika Holly Maduka was born in a hospitable town of Amawbia, in Eastern Nigeria, to the family of Mr. and Mrs. Victor Chukwuma Katchi. She started her educational career at a young age and is still advancing. An administrator, educationist, and a psychologist, Maduka acquired her B.Ed in Educational Administration and Supervision from the Nnamdi Azikiwe University (UNIZIK) Awka in 1999. In 2010 she obtained her Post-Graduate Diploma in Election Administration (PGDEA) and Masters in Personnel Psychology in 2012 from the University of Ibadan. She is a Christian Women Leader, a Chorister, a Church Teacher, and a Poet. Apart from her academic and professional career, she is developing career in writing. The Mystery Coconuts is her first book among many. Maduka is happily married to Pastor Sam I. Maduka (CNA). The marriage is blessed with three 'jewels:' a Princess, Victoria, and two Princes, Faith and Divine.
